 Hi all,

 

 The clockscheme in my design is as shown in the jpeg.

 

Can anyone please help me with the generation of the clock tree file for this clock scheme ( a sample ctstch file for the scheme will be good enough).

Kindly give me some idea of giving the MaxDelay,MinDelay,MaxSkew  values for the clock with respect to the jitter and Tlock specified in the diagram.

     Encounter can generate the .ctstch file for you. Start with that, then adjust as needed. Jitter is usually considered when coming up with the set_clock_uncertainty constraint in the SDC file.
